Penn State Behrend vs. YCP
Both Pennsylvania State University-Penn State Erie-Behrend College and York College of Pennsylvania are 4 years schools located in Pennsylvania. The following statements compare Pennsylvania State University-Penn State Erie-Behrend College and York College of Pennsylvania with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
- Penn State Behrend's tuition ($26,668) is more expensive than YCP ($24,606).
- YCP's acceptance rate (94.20%) is lower than Penn State Behrend (95.71%).
- Penn State Behrend has higher yield (18.74%) than YCP (17.32%).
- Penn State Behrend's SAT score (1,210) is higher than YCP (1,130).
- Penn State Behrend's students to faculty ratio (12 to 1) is lower than YCP (13 to 1).
- YCP (3,720 students) is larger than Penn State Behrend (3,323 students) with more enrolled students.
- YCP ($11,916) has higher amount of financial aid than Penn State Behrend ($10,547).
- YCP's graduation rate (60%) is higher than Penn State Behrend (46%).
